Outline of Final Research Achievements |
We developed an algorithm for retrieving intramolecular charge distributions from spectral-interferences appearing in energy- and angular-distributions of scattered electrons originating from laser-assisted electron scattering (LAES) processes. We developed a LAES apparatus with high sensitivity and generated ultrashort laser pulses with the duration of 9 fs by the hollow-core-fiber compression method. Furthermore, we developed a computational program for calculating LAES signals induced by broadband ultrashort laser pulses, and showed that observation of spectral-interferences of LAES signals should be feasible. We proposed a new ultrafast electron diffraction method by using single-cycle THz-wave pulses, and demonstrated its performance by numerical simulations.
